1,000 WOMEN PREPARE TO RACE FOR LIFE

RUNNERS, joggers and walkers will be lining up at Walton Hall Gardens to Race for Life this Sunday.

A total of 1,000 women have put their names down to tackle the three-mile race, sponsored by the Warrington Guardian.

The course is a mixture of paths and roads crossing Appleton reservoir and the Bridgewater Canal.

Whether you are running Sunday's race because you are a survivor or you want to dedicate your race in memory of or in celebration of a loved one, the focus of the day is on having fun and raising money.

Organisers have asked anyone taking part to arrive early and to share lifts where possible.

If you are travelling by car, take the A56 out of Warrington and turn left after the Walton Arms.

Alternatively, from the M56 come off at junction 11, follow the A56 to Warrington and turn right at the Walton Arms.

There is a pay and display car park at Walton Hall Gardens.
